US national arrested on charge of rape
- Written by E.Tsiliopoulos
35-year-old woman from the United States has been arrested on the island of Rhodes and charged with raping a 20-year-old woman, also a U.S. national, the police announced on Monday.
The suspect was arrested on Sunday, following a complaint filed by the 20-year-old.
According to sources, the younger woman went to the Ialyssos police station early Sunday morning and reported that she had been assaulted while she was out at a club. She said that the 35-year-old attacked her when she went to the toilet, pushed her against the wall, and sexually abused her.
Police located and arrested the 35-year-old woman, who will be appear before the local prosecutor on a rape charge.
